WebThe flathead sole (Hippoglossoides elassodon) is a flatfish of the family Pleuronectidae.It is a demersal fish that lives on soft, silty or muddy bottoms at depths of up to 1,050 metres (3,440 ft). WebThe flathead catfish has a broad, flattened head with small eyes on top. The lower jaw projects beyond the upper jaw. It occurs in most of the large streams of Missouri, preferring places with a slow current. Missouri catfishes have smooth, scaleless skin and barbels (“whiskers”) around the mouth.
